What kind of chicken thighs should I use?

You can use either bone-in, skin-on or bone-in, skinless chicken thighs for this recipe. Bone-in thighs retain more moisture and impart richer flavor, while skinless thighs are a healthier option. Ultimately, the choice depends on your personal preference.

How long do chicken thighs take in a slow cooker?

Cooking time depends on your slow cooker and the size of your chicken thighs. Generally:

  • Low setting: 6-8 hours
  • High setting: 3-4 hours

Always ensure the intern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C) before serving. Using a meat thermometer is crucial to guarantee food safety.

What are the best seasonings for crockpot chicken thighs?

The beauty of crockpot chicken thighs lies in their adaptability. Here are a few ideas:

  • Classic Simple: Salt, pepper, garlic powder, onion powder.
  • Spicy: Paprika, chili powder, cayenne pepper, cumin.
  • Herby: Rosemary, thyme, oregano, parsley.
  • Sweet and Savory: Brown sugar, soy sauce, honey, ginger.

What are some delicious crockpot chicken thigh recipes?

The possibilities are endless! Here are a few ideas to get you started:

  • Crockpot BBQ Chicken Thighs: Toss the chicken in your favorite BBQ sauce during the last hour of cooking.
  • Crockpot Buffalo Chicken Thighs: Add buffalo wing sauce during the last 30 minutes for a spicy kick.
  • Crockpot Lemon Herb Chicken Thighs: Use lemon juice, garlic, and herbs for a bright and flavorful dish.
  • Crockpot Creamy Tomato Chicken Thighs: Add canned diced tomatoes, cream, and Italian seasoning for a comforting meal.

How do I make sure my crockpot chicken thighs aren't dry?

The key to juicy crockpot chicken thighs is to avoid overcrowding the slow cooker. Ensure there's enough space between the chicken pieces for even cooking. Adding a liquid like broth or water to the bottom of the slow cooker can also help prevent dryness.
